how picky are Xeon chips (LGA2011V1/V2 CPUs) when it comes to RAM?

mrjayviper

Junior Member
I haven't had experience before with server setup but when using a desktop CPU, I haven't had any issues pairing any sort of RAM (even RAM not listed in the motherboard's official compatibility list).

Should I have the same expectation when it comes to the CPUs above? I'll be using server grade motherboard (Intel dual CPU board).

I haven't bought the RAM cause of this "dilemma".

Thanks
 
Or you could download or read the manual for the particular Intel motherboard you are using. 😉
The CPUs you listed can use either regular memory or ECC memory (but not mixed).
It all depends on the motherboard and your needs.
